Ana Hotels appoints Vasile Iuga as president of the Administration Council starting July 1. He will replace Alexandra Copos de Prada, who decided to dedicate to her business that she leads since 2014, Ana Pan.
Iuga has a management experience of 26 years within PwC, where he worked since 1991 and where he became international partner since 1997. Between 2004 and 2015 he was country managing partner, coordinating 600 employees from five regional offices.
Between 2008 and 2015, he was managing partner of PwC South-Eastern Europe, having under the subordination of the company activity from nine countries. Since 2004, he was member of the PwC Central and Eastern Europe management Board.
He has a Bachelor’s degree from the Aeronautics Faculty within the Bucharest Polytechnics Institute. He graduates courses at Harvard Business School, London Business School, Institut Européen d’Administration des Affaires / European Institute of Business Administration (INSEAD, Fontainebleau, Paris) and International Institute for Management Development (IMD, Lausanne).
